Output 5208f266c60f21ca47c605b6941a6ddee35d966504086cca41182f8a5202fb4a:1

value
576441
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34f06e324486646a53e0399a12333f0710f6a12d OP_EQUALVERIFY OP_CHECKSIG
address
15pvANoxUa4HVqvfXWiRb7enJLrb6fARY3
transaction
5208f266c60f21ca47c605b6941a6ddee35d966504086cca41182f8a5202fb4a
confirmations
293024
spent
true